How do you remove the bios password on the Dell Inspirion 3200? Is
there anyway to do it other than breaking into it?

Request for Question Clarification by livioflores-ga on 22 Mar 2005 19:36 PST
Let us know the version of your BIOS (full info) and, if possible, the
model# of your motherboard and we can give you an accurate answer.
But the easy way is to remove the battery of the motherboard and then
replace it  again.

If/when you remove the battery, wait five minutes to make sure it is
clear. In fact, I would suggest replacing the battery as they will
eventually lose power and can cause mysterious system problems and
headaches.

Many motherboards have a jumper for password reset, but popping the
battery and being done with it is the best way IMHO.
